안녕하세요 작가님! 교재 관련해서 질문이 있어 비슷한 내용의 강의에 여쭤봅니다. 211페이지 직접 해보는 손코딩 쪽에 '2차원 리스트에 반복문 두번 사용하기' 가 있는데, 이 위에는 "중첩된 리스트 내부에 있는 요소를 하나하나 출력할 수 있다"는 내용이 나와있습니다. 그렇다면 코딩 마지막에 있는 print(items)가 print(item)이 돼서 실행 결과가 1,2,3,4,5,6,7,8,9가 순차적으로 출력되는 결과가 나와야 하지 않나요? 교재에 나와있는 실행 결과에는 내부 요소를 하나하나 출력한다는 내용과는 거리가 먼 것 같아서 여쭤봅니다! 강의 유익하게 보고 있습니다! 학교 정보시간에 매우 많은 도움이 됩니다! 감사합니다!!
G메일에 위 글들이 떠서 G메일에서 보넸더니 여기에 안 떠서 이 글을 여기에 다시 올려봅니다. G메일에서 보내면 메일로 가는 줄을 몰랐습니다.(죄송) # 1 ~ ? 까지 더하기 =================== x = int(input("숫자 입력 : ")) y = x + 1 if x % 2 == 0 : a = x // 2 # 여기서 a 변수를 만들었는데 아래 print(f"1부터 {x}까지의 합은 \"{y * a}\" 입니다.") else: a = x // 2 # 여기서 a변수가 적용되지않아 다시 식을 넣었습니다. b = a + 1 print(f"1부터 {x}까지의 합은 \"{(y * a) + b}\"입니다.") print(a) # a 변수가 살아있는데 else: 문에서 적용이 안되는 이유를 알고 싶네요
발음이 또박또박 하셔서, 회사에서 뮤팅해놓고도 공부하기 참 좋네요 ㅋ
4:02 제 고민도 늘 "아니 저딴 것 엇다 써"였는데 말이죠..ㅎㅎ
강의 들을 때 마다 이런 내용도 모르고 제가 ADsP랑 빅데이터분석기사를 어떻게 취득했는지 모르겠어요.. ㅎㅎ 좋은 강의 감사드립니다. 머리에 콕콕 저장됩니다.
안녕하세요. 감사히 잘 봤어요.
3회차 반복해요.
전개 연산자 이름은 기억하고 새카맣게 까먹었네요. 계속 반복해야지요.
2023년 8월 15일 화 16시10분 태평양 시간
안녕하세요. 부지런히 따라 가고 있어요.
전개 연산자 들어도 기억이 안나네요.
10개월 전에도 그러더니 반복문이 됐어요.
2024년 7월 11일 목 15시 태평양 시간
안녕하세요. 감사히 잘 봤어요.
조금전 전체 영상 마치고 다시 반복해서 기억지속하려 해요.
2023년 7월 14일 금 22시22분 태평양 시간
안녕하세요. 감사히 잘 봤어요.
2023년 7월 3일 월 23시 태평양 시간
행렬도 간단히 설명해 주세요~감사합니다^^
2회차 완료
안녕하세요 작가님! 교재 관련해서 질문이 있어 비슷한 내용의 강의에 여쭤봅니다.
211페이지 직접 해보는 손코딩 쪽에 '2차원 리스트에 반복문 두번 사용하기' 가 있는데, 이 위에는 "중첩된 리스트 내부에 있는 요소를 하나하나 출력할 수 있다"는 내용이 나와있습니다.
그렇다면 코딩 마지막에 있는 print(items)가 print(item)이 돼서 실행 결과가 1,2,3,4,5,6,7,8,9가 순차적으로 출력되는 결과가 나와야 하지 않나요? 교재에 나와있는 실행 결과에는 내부 요소를 하나하나 출력한다는 내용과는 거리가 먼 것 같아서 여쭤봅니다!
강의 유익하게 보고 있습니다! 학교 정보시간에 매우 많은 도움이 됩니다! 감사합니다!!
맞습니다 😂..... 오탈자입니다 😂....!!
@@윤인성 아핳 그렇군요 감사합니다!
파이팅하세요!
개정판에 추가된 내용이군요.
가끔 저게 뭐지 하는 코드가 있었는데 감사합니다~ ^^
2023.11.28 ✔️
a = [1, 2, 3, 4, 5]
sum = 0
for b in a:
sum = sum + b
print(sum)
a는 계속 남아있을 것이고, b는 없어지는 건가요 아님 계속 떠도나요?
파이썬은 남아서 유지됩니다!
해당 코드 뒤에 print(b)해보시면 남는다는걸 눈으로 확인하실 수 있습니다!
@@윤인성감사합니다. 그러면 b변수까지 없애려면 어떻게 해야 합니까?
@@hyunlee5670 delete b로 제거하면 되기는 하지만, 일반적으로 그냥 냅둡니다!
@@윤인성 아! 답변 감사합니다. 강의 잘 보고 따라하고 있습니다.
G메일에 위 글들이 떠서 G메일에서 보넸더니 여기에 안 떠서 이 글을 여기에
다시 올려봅니다. G메일에서 보내면 메일로 가는 줄을 몰랐습니다.(죄송)
# 1 ~ ? 까지 더하기 ===================
x = int(input("숫자 입력 : "))
y = x + 1
if x % 2 == 0 :
a = x // 2 # 여기서 a 변수를 만들었는데 아래
print(f"1부터 {x}까지의 합은 \"{y * a}\" 입니다.")
else:
a = x // 2 # 여기서 a변수가 적용되지않아 다시 식을 넣었습니다.
b = a + 1
print(f"1부터 {x}까지의 합은 \"{(y * a) + b}\"입니다.")
print(a) # a 변수가 살아있는데 else: 문에서 적용이 안되는 이유를 알고 싶네요
2/10 도장콩
혼공파 211p.g에 손코딩 오타 난거 같아요.
앗 어디에 어떤 오타가 있는지 알려주실 수 있을까요!
@@윤인성 맨밑에 print(items)랑 실행결과요
앗 그렇군요!
오탈자 제보 감사드립니다 @_@ !